Bihar: In yet another tragic incident, sudden fire massively broke out in the showroom of Hero Company in the early morning of Thursday near Nagar Nausa Road, Khusrupur, Patna. In the accident, a guard working in the showroom died due to burning alive. At the same time, more than 50 vehicles kept in the showroom also turned to ashes. It is believed that there has been a loss of lakhs of rupees due to this accident.
Within no time, the entire showroom caught fire and the entire showroom started burning in flames. The local people informed the local police station and fire brigade about the fire. After which the police team and 5 vehicles of the fire brigade reached the spot and after hours of effort, the fire could be controlled. Meanwhile, dozens of vehicles kept in the showroom were burnt to ashes.
The people around told about the incident that at around 4:00 am on Thursday morning suddenly smoke started rising in Maa Kali Automobile Hero Showroom of Khusrupur. Within no time, the smoke took the form of fire and the entire showroom started burning rapidly. Meanwhile, as soon as the information about the fire was received among the nearby people, sensation spread in the entire area.
The deceased guard has been identified as a youth named Roshan Kumar. Who was a resident of the nearby village. People around told that Roshan Kumar was inside the showroom when the fire broke out. Roshan died due to the fire. At the same time, there were more than 100 vehicles in the Hero showroom. In which more than half the vehicles were burnt to ashes.
